Position Summary: A Clinical Outreach Representative is responsible for marketing efforts in a specific region as assigned to them by the Regional Director of Clinical Outreach. Within this specific region, they are to increase awareness of Discovery Behavioral Health, the division they represent, and the specific brand they have been hired for. Outreach representatives are to develop referral sources, maintain relationships internally and externally, and ultimately drive admissions to the organization. Essential Job Functions: Creating and executing regional strategic marketing plans.  Increase referrals and admissions for continued company growth. Develop and maintain referral relationships amongst various healthcare professionals.  Maintain activity levels equating to 85 field meetings including 5 onsite tours, 3 in-services per month or as assigned by the Regional Director of Clinical Outreach. Contribute to referral and admissions prospects goals as identified by the Regional Director of Clinical Outreach. Maintain Sales Force database and activity record Add new contacts into Sales Force: all contact information, regional assignment, and categorize, update accounts when necessary. Keep activities and events logged appropriately in Sales Force. Complete weekly and end of month reports in a timely manner: mileage reports, credit card reports, end of month reporting, and other reports as identified by Regional Director. Assist Regional Director/Territory Manager in identifying new opportunities for marketing efforts: direct mail, online, and community based. Facilitate and support communication between outreach and admissions, outreach and clinical, outreach and management. Facilitate and support communication between referral sources and admissions, referral sources and clinical, and referrals throughout Discovery Behavioral Health as a whole. Knowledge, Education, Experience: Bachelor’s degree (B.A.) from four-year college or university At least three years of experience working in direct outreach or clinical experience in the mental health field Substance Use Experience Preferred   Employment Status: Full-Time  Schedule: Monday-Friday Work Location: Remote - Must be located in Bergen County, NJ Compensation: Pay Range: $75,000 - 115,000/annually
